Firstly I would say stop breeding, which you are doing so that's good.
What do you feed your gliders? Poor diet affects the development of the unborn and also as they grow and develop. I'm not saying you're not feeding them properly but it's something we need to rule out.
Otherwise I would put it down to inbreeding or other genetic problems but it's impossible to tell without a thorough vet examination.
